Output 41354f4f2496759e5eca5c9bdcc830441743ec2c143059221d4bcf168c9a6b89:21

value
3950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fe1fc75725417eb2ef27df401e244d10bf5b27e OP_EQUALVERIFY OP_CHECKSIG
address
1BCaj64oXJgQaNtyuw7Px7MiGfuYU7qh3S
transaction
41354f4f2496759e5eca5c9bdcc830441743ec2c143059221d4bcf168c9a6b89
spent
true